President Trump is planning to eliminate the diversity visa lottery, a program he blamed for allowing the New York City’s Halloween terror attacker in the US.
Conservative lawmakers have proposed eliminating the diversity visa lottery – in a bill that slashes legal immigration in half within a decade by limiting the ability of American citizens and legal residents to bring family members into the country.
